📌  相关文章
📜  添加外部 jar 依赖项以分级构建 (1)

📅  最后修改于: 2023-12-03 15:11:07.331000             🧑  作者: Mango

添加外部 jar 依赖项以分级构建

在 Java 开发中,我们通常需要使用第三方库来完成一些功能。这些库以 jar 包的形式提供给我们使用。在分级构建系统中,我们需要添加这些外部 jar 依赖项。

第一步:下载依赖项 jar 包

在 Maven Central Repository 和 GitHub 等平台上下载所需的 jar 包。将下载的 jar 包保存在本地目录中。例如,将下载的 jar 包保存在 <project_root>/libs 目录中。

第二步:添加依赖项到构建文件

在分级构建系统中,我们需要将这些外部 jar 包添加到构建文件中。以 Gradle 构建系统为例,我们可以使用以下语法添加依赖项:

dependencies {
    compile files('libs/foo.jar', 'libs/bar.jar')
}

其中,compile 是指定依赖项的作用域,files 表示依赖项的来源,'libs/foo.jar', 'libs/bar.jar' 是依赖项文件的路径。

如果存在多个依赖项,也可以使用以下语法:

dependencies {
    compile fileTree(dir: 'libs', include: ['*.jar'])
}

其中,fileTree 使用一个目录中所有符合条件的文件作为依赖项,dir 是指定目录,include 是指定文件名匹配模式。

第三步:重新构建

添加依赖项后,我们需要重新构建项目以使其生效。在 Gradle 构建系统中,我们可以使用以下命令:

./gradlew clean build

其中,clean 是指清理构建目录,build 是指构建项目。在其他构建系统中,也有类似的命令。

总结

添加外部 jar 依赖项是分级构建系统中常用的操作。通过上述步骤,我们可以顺利地将依赖项添加到项目中,并享受第三方库带来的便利。